Compare Text Blaze and Save to Pocket: Which Extension is the Best?

Text Blaze is a powerful text expander tool that saves you time by automating repetitive typing tasks. Loved by over 400,000 users, it's perfect for professionals across various fields.
Save to Pocket is a browser extension that lets you save articles, videos, and more. With over 2 M+ users, it promises a cross-device reading experience for perfect organization. But does it deliver?
Key Features
  • Automate Repetitive Typing: Insert standard greetings, commonly used phrases, and more.
  • Works Anywhere: Compatible with text fields on any website.
  • Placeholders: Use text fields, dropdown menus, dates, toggles, and more.
  • Dynamic Templates: Automatically insert the current date, perform date calculations, and more.
  • Team Collaboration: Share and collaborate on snippets with your team.
  • AutoPilot: Automate form filling with simulated key presses.
  • Search Templates: Quickly search templates from any web page.
  • One-Click Saving: Save articles, videos, and more with a single click.
  • Cross-Device Sync: Access your saved content across all your devices.
  • Tagging System: Organize your saved items with tags.
  • Clean Reading Environment: Enjoy a distraction-free space to read your saved content.
  • Pocket Premium: Offers additional features like custom fonts, a permanent library, and unlimited highlights.

7.2

Save to Pocket offers a range of useful functions.
The standard is that of saving websites with one click and subsequent cross-device synchronization. This worked almost in real-time in the test and is a strong advantage of the tool.

The tagging system is particularly helpful for anyone who wants to organize and find their tags. This did not always work perfectly in the test. Sometimes websites were tagged, but these did not appear in the search with a unique search term.

Compared to competitors such as Web-Highlights, the highlighting function is only possible after saving a website in the pocket and then searching there. It is not possible to highlight directly on the website.

6.0

The extension works when saving and synchronizing content on different devices. This happens almost in real-time.
However, there are performance problems with the login process, where the tab is closed on the first attempt without a login. It worked on the second attempt. There are many reports of problems with the login process in the reviews.
Searching for tags also did not work properly, 4 pages were tagged with “Web Clipper”, when searching for it only 2 pages were displayed again.
